Setting Up Dialup Access on Mac OSX
This tutorial describes in detail how to connect your Macintosh computer running the
OSX operating system tthe Internet for the FIRST TIME. It is intended for
new customers, or current customers who are trying to connect a new machine for the FIRST
TIME.
- To begin setting up your connection, click on the Apple menu, and select "System
Preferences..."
- Once the System Preferences window loads, click on "Network" to load the
Network Preferences.
- In the Network Preferences pane, set location to "Automatic," and set Show to
"Internal Modem." Set Configure to "use PPP." The "Domain Name
Servers" should be left blank. The "Search Domain" should be blank as well.
When you've entered this, click on the "PPP" tab.
- In the PPP tab, Service Provider should be "mav". The telephone number should
be: 896-4800. The Account name is your Maverick account name, and the password is your
Maverick password. If you don't want to have to type in your password everytime you
connect, check the "save password" box.
Look closely at the username that you
entered. It should look like an email address. If your username is johndoe, then your
username on this screen should look like johndoe@maverickbbs.com
if it doesn't, add @maverickbbs.com to the username. If you do
not know what your maverick username is,contact us at 896-4595
- If you would like to change the PPP options, click on the "PPP Options"
button, and make changes there. If you want to automatically connect to maverick when you
open your web browser, or email program, or any TCP/IP application, make sure that
"Connect automatically when starting TCP/IP applications" is checked. If it's
unchecked, you will have to connect manually using the Internet Connect application. Click
"OK" to exit PPP Options.
- By default, the proxy settings tab is blank. Maverick does not require proxy settings.
Leave these blank.
- If you ever need to change your internal modem protocol from V90 to V34, you would do so
by clicking on the "Modem:" pulldown menu, and selecting "Apple Internal
56k Modem(V.34)." Make sure that the modem is set to "tone" dialing instead
of "pulse."
- Once you are all through configuring the network preferences, click on "Apply
Now" and close the window.
